Explanation of the Science Behind Spinning Tops:

1. Gravity and Balance: Normally, if you try to balance a pencil on its tip, it falls over immediately because gravity pulls the center of mass down, and any tiny tilt makes it fall further. This is an unstable equilibrium.
2. Angular Momentum: When you spin a top, you give it something called *angular momentum*. Think of this as "spinning energy" that wants to keep the top spinning in the same direction and axis.
3. Gyroscopic Effect: Because the top is spinning fast, it resists changes to its orientation. This resistance is called the gyroscopic effect. Even though gravity is trying to pull the top over, the angular momentum pushes back, keeping the top upright.
4. Friction and Precession: Eventually, friction between the tip of the top and the surface (and air resistance) slows the top down. As it loses speed, it loses angular momentum. Gravity starts to win, causing the top to wobble (this wobble is called *precession*) and eventually fall over.

Key Forces Involved:
* Gravity: Pulls the top down.
* Normal Force: The table pushes up against the top's tip.
* Friction: Slows the spin at the tip.
* Applied Force: The twist of your fingers that starts the spin.
